Caparo Promoted within Coldwell Banker Preferred
H. Daniel Caparo Promoted to Vice President of Strategic Growth for Real Estate Company

David Krieger, president of Coldwell Banker Preferred, is pleased to announce that Maple Glen resident H. Daniel Caparo has been promoted to vice president of strategic growth for Coldwell Banker Preferred. In this newly created position, Caparo will be responsible for pursuing expansion opportunities in the greater Philadelphia area for the company.
“Dan has been an integral part of Coldwell Banker Preferred since he affiliated with the company as a sales professional 30 years ago. Since then, he has been promoted to various management positions where he has been instrumental in the success of the company,” said Krieger. “Dan’s first-hand real estate sales and management experience, combined with his understanding of the needs of our sales associates and that of our customers and clients, makes him well-positioned to lead the company in seeking opportunities for growth.”
As a successful real estate professional, Caparo was named Rookie of the Year in 1992 and was recognized with the Coldwell Banker International President’s Circle award designation from 1994-2002. He caught the attention of the leadership team and was promoted in 1996 to branch manager of the Conshohocken office. During his tenure, the Conshohocken office was recognized for its strong performance. Since 1998, Caparo has been a partner in the company.

From 2008-2012, he served as district branch manager of both the Conshohocken and Blue Bell offices and then remained branch vice president of the Blue Bell office until present. During his tenure as branch vice president of the Blue Bell office, Caparo delivered steady performance with the office earning recognition within NRT as a consistent performer since 2013 among the top 20 percent of all NRT offices nationwide. In addition, Caparo has earned personal designation to the NRT President’s Council for multiple years as a leading manager. NRT is the parent company of Coldwell Banker Preferred.
“It has been a privilege to work with such an outstanding group of real estate professionals in the Blue Bell office. I will truly miss the everyday camaraderie and the productive, enthusiastic professional environment,” said Caparo. “I am honored to have this wonderful opportunity to expand my leadership role and I am looking forward to strengthening Coldwell Banker Preferred’s position in the marketplace.”

Caparo is a member of the National Association of REALTORS® and has achieved the Accredited Buyer’s Representative (ABR), Certified Real Estate Brokerage Manager (CRB), Graduate REALTOR® Institute (GRI), Senior Real Estate Specialist (SRES) and Certified Residential Specialist (CRS) designations and ePRO® certification.
A 1991 graduate of Villanova University, Caparo resides in Maple Glen with his wife, Tina, and daughter, Taylor.
Coldwell Banker Preferred has ten offices and a sales force of nearly 700 affiliated sales associates and staff serving the communities of the Greater Philadelphia area and the Delaware Valley, including northern Delaware and southern New Jersey.
